Roger Vivier found artistic expression in the sculpting of a last as well as in the designing of the arch of a heel and the angle of a toe. Vivier realized the details of his designs by creating pullovers. Pull-overs are three dimensional models of shoes made during the design phase of shoe production and consist of shoe uppers that have been pulled onto and over wooden lasts to show the design of a new style. The Bata Shoe Museum collection holds eighty pullovers by Vivier from his time with the House of Dior. Image copyright © 2012 Bata Shoe Museum, Toronto, Canada (CNW Group/Bata Shoe Museum)
